Following are some of the most common pests that can be found around the Houston area –

Fleas – Warm and moist places are a breeding ground for fleas, and Houston is both of those things. Not just a problem for pets, fleas can become a major discomfort for humans as well. They also have been known to transmit diseases, so getting rid of your fleas as soon as possible is a smart idea.

Silverfish – Also a pest that loves the warm and humid environment that Houston has to offer, Silverfish are good at hiding, which makes them that much more difficult to eradicate. These tiny little critters are not a major threat to the structure of a building, but they are unwelcome in your home nonetheless and should be eliminated.

Ants – It is usually easy to find ants in just about any environment, and you probably wouldn’t have trouble locating some either near or inside your Houston home. Pest control in Houston involves keeping track of the ant population near a building and making sure that very few of them make their way inside. Depending on the specific species of ant that you are dealing with, these tiny creatures have an amazing ability to do damage to a structure.

Cockroaches – This pest is near the top of the list for insects that most people are afraid of – or at least grossed-out by. The weather in Houston is perfect for the growth of a cockroach population, and they love to work their way inside through cracks and tiny openings anywhere in a building. Because they are mostly nighttime creatures, cockroaches can be hard to find until there is a large population already in place.

Rodents – There are multiple kinds of rats and mice around the Houston area that may be able to make their way into your home through very small openings. If you suspect you have a mice or rat problem, you should address it immediately because these creatures can do serious damage to your home if left uncontrolled. Houston pest control requires diligent attention to the spread of rodent activity to ensure that your home or business is safe from the damage that they can do.

Termites – For most people, your home is the most valuable thing that you own. The need for pest control in Houston is largely dictated by the huge population of termites in the area. The weather is perfect for termites to live here and feast on the wood framework of area homes. While you might not even know they are around, the Houston Termite can be doing major damage to your house and destroying your investment. Prevention is Key for Pest Control in Houston

Prevention is key to Houston pest control and there are steps you can take around the house to reduce the chances of having a major pest problem in your home. Some of the most important measures you can take include:

  •     Sealing up the exterior of your home where entry points may exists for pests to enter
  •     Make sure your garbage is stored in sealed containers and don’t let it sit around the house for long periods of time
  •     Repair any damage to your roof immediately
  •     Store wood (such as firewood) a safe distance from the house and off the ground
  •     Prevent trees or shrubs from growing too close to your house
